The Role of SASSA in South Africa
SASSA is highly responsible for administering and distributing social grants, including child support grants, disability grants, old-age pensions, and other forms of social assistance. For millions of South Africans, these grants are very important for basic survival, covering major expenses such as food, healthcare, and education.
With such a vast network of beneficiaries spread across both urban and rural areas, SASSA faces logistical challenges in reaching every individual, especially in remote regions where access to services is limited. The effective and secure distribution of social grants requires a coordinated approach, and in recent years, courier services have emerged as key partners in ensuring that the distribution of critical documents and benefits runs smoothly.
How Courier Services Support SASSA’s Mission
Delivery of Critical Documents
One of the key roles courier services play in supporting SASSA is the delivery of important documents. These include:
Grant Application Forms: Many individuals, particularly those in rural or remote areas of SOuth Africa, face challenges in accessing physical SASSA offices to collect or submit application forms. Courier services bridge this gap by delivering these forms directly to applicants, reducing the need for travel and ensuring that people who are eligible for grants can apply promptly.
Approval and Rejection Letters: Once a grant application is processed, SASSA needs to notify applicants about the outcome of their application. Courier services ensure that approval or rejection letters are delivered securely and directly to the recipients, preventing delays that could affect the livelihoods of applicants.
Reissue of Benefit Cards: SASSA grant recipients receive electronic benefit cards, which are essential for withdrawing funds from ATMs or making purchases. If a card is lost or stolen, SASSA issues a new one. Courier services are often tasked with delivering these new cards securely to the beneficiaries.
Improving Accessibility for Rural Populations
South Africa is home to many rural communities, where access to basic services can be challenging. These regions often lack adequate transportation, and SASSA beneficiaries might have to travel long distances to reach a service center. Courier services help eliminate this barrier by delivering SASSA-related materials and grants directly to the doorstep of rural beneficiaries. This not only saves time and effort but also reduces the financial burden of traveling for grant-related needs.
Timely Distribution of Emergency Relief
During times of crisis, such as the COVID-19 pandemic or natural disasters, SASSA has had to step up its efforts to provide emergency relief grants. Courier services have played a vital role in the distribution of emergency funds, documents, and even food parcels to those who are most affected. By ensuring that these essential items are delivered quickly and securely, courier services help SASSA extend its reach and offer support to individuals during periods of heightened need.
Facilitating Document Submissions
Courier services don’t only assist with deliveries to beneficiaries—they also support the efficient submission of documents from applicants to SASSA offices. For example, beneficiaries who need to provide proof of identity, residency, or other documentation can do so through a trusted courier service. This reduces congestion at SASSA offices and enables faster processing times, benefiting both the agency and the applicants.
Ensuring Security and Confidentiality
Given the sensitive nature of the documents and benefits that SASSA handles, maintaining security and confidentiality is paramount. Courier services offer a secure method of transporting important materials, from benefit cards to personal identification documents. By employing tracking systems, secure packaging, and signature-based deliveries, courier services help SASSA maintain a high level of security and accountability in the distribution process.
The Benefits of Using Courier Services
- Efficiency: Courier services provide a faster and more reliable method of document and material delivery compared to traditional postal services, especially in areas where postal services are slow or unreliable.
- Security: With the use of advanced tracking technology and secure handling protocols, courier services minimize the risk of lost or stolen documents, ensuring that SASSA materials reach their intended recipients.
- Reach: Couriers can deliver to even the most remote areas, overcoming geographical barriers that would otherwise hinder SASSA’s ability to reach certain populations.
- Cost-Effectiveness: By using courier services, SASSA can avoid the high costs associated with setting up physical offices in every region. Instead, they can rely on an existing infrastructure to deliver services efficiently.
Challenges and Considerations
While courier services provide a range of benefits to SASSA, there are some challenges to consider. For example:
- Cost: Outsourcing courier services can be expensive, and with SASSA’s limited budget, there must be a balance between cost-efficiency and the need for reliable service.
- Rural Infrastructure: In some rural areas, poor road conditions or lack of proper infrastructure can delay courier deliveries, potentially affecting SASSA’s ability to provide timely services.
- Scalability: As the number of beneficiaries continues to grow, SASSA may need to expand its partnerships with courier companies to ensure they can keep up with the increasing demand for document and benefit delivery.
